Árvore de páginas

Versões comparadas

Chave

  • Esta linha foi adicionada.
  • Esta linha foi removida.
  • A formatação mudou.

...

Ao informar um determinado Valor/Desconto Pretendido, é exibida a mensagem "Não é possível a aplicação do desconto solicitado. Será dado o desconto máximo para todos os itens."

03. SOLUÇÃO

A mensagem

...

é

...

exibida quando, ao informar um Valor/Desconto Pretendido, o desconto solicitado não pode ser aplicado integralmente, pois comprometeria a margem mínima definida na política de desconto da empresa.

Motivo:

...

Nesses casos, quando não é mais possível distribuir o desconto entre os itens

...

do orçamento sem ultrapassar os limites permitidos, o sistema aplica automaticamente o maior desconto possível que

...

respeite as regras

...

comerciais vigentes.


Cálculo do valor mínimo permitido:

  1. Se houver promoção ativa:
    O valor mínimo permitido será o valor promocional do item.

  2. Se não houver promoção, mas existir política de desconto com margem mínima definida:
    O valor mínimo será calculado com base na seguinte fórmula:
    Preço mínimo = (NPERCMIN / 100) * B2_CM1 + B2_CM1
    Onde:

    • NPERCMIN é o percentual mínimo de margem definido na política;

    • B2_CM1 é o custo do item.

  3. Se não houver política de desconto definida:
    O sistema utiliza o parâmetro MV_FORMALI para definir o preço mínimo com margem, assumindo margem de 0%, ou seja:
    Preço mínimo = B2_CM1

Totvs custom tabs box
tabsComo resolver / configurar corretamente, Resumo da SoluçãoExemplo - Critério Desconto Por Promoção, Exemplo - Critério Desconto Por Grupo Peça
idspasso1,passo2
Totvs custom tabs box items
defaultyes
referenciapasso1

Caso exista um valor promocional vigente para a peça, o desconto aplicado deverá respeitar esse limite, de forma que o valor total do item em promoção, com o desconto, não ultrapasse o valor definido pela promoção.

Se o desconto necessário para atingir o valor pretendido exceder esse limite, o valor excedente será redistribuído entre os demais itens do orçamento, conforme as regras comerciais vigentes.

Image Added

  • Verifique as fórmulas dos parâmetros MV_FORMALI e MV_FORMALU:

    Acesse o SIGACFG > Ambientes > Cadastros > Parâmetros (CFGX017) e valide os conteúdos:

    • MV_FORMALI: deve garantir o cálculo correto da margem mínima (sem permitir prejuízo).

    • MV_FORMALU: responsável por calcular e exibir corretamente a margem de lucro na tela do orçamento.

  • Configure corretamente a margem mínima de lucro no cadastro de política de descontos. Essa margem será utilizada pela variável NPERCMIN nas fórmulas.

  • Ao informar o campo "Val.Pretendid" (VS1_VALPRE) na rotina OFIXA011:

  • O sistema tentará ratear o desconto proporcionalmente entre os itens.

  • Se algum item atingir o valor mínimo calculado por MV_FORMALI antes de alcançar o valor pretendido, o sistema impede e exibe a mensagem de alerta.

    Totvs custom tabs box items
    defaultno
    referenciapasso2

    A mensagem ocorre por proteção automática do sistema contra prejuízo financeiro. A lógica está atrelada às fórmulas dos parâmetros MV_FORMALI e MV_FORMALU, que garantem:

    • Que os itens não sejam vendidos abaixo do custo com a margem mínima;

    • Que a política de descontos da empresa seja respeitada;

    • Que o valor pretendido informado no orçamento seja respeitado até o limite permitido.

    Dica Final: Caso seja necessário aplicar valores pretendidos mais agressivos, revise:

    • A margem mínima permitida na política de descontos;

    • As fórmulas dos parâmetros, com acompanhamento da área fiscal e comercial.

    Se quiser, posso te ajudar a montar uma fórmula específica para o MV_FORMALI ou MV_FORMALU com base nas regras do seu negócio.

    04. DEMAIS INFORMAÇÕES

    ...

    Quando for identificada uma política de desconto vigente com percentual de margem mínima definido, esse valor será utilizado no cálculo para determinar o valor mínimo permitido para o item.

    Esse limite será considerado na tentativa de atingir o valor pretendido, garantindo que a margem mínima seja respeitada.

    Parâmetro MV_FORMALI

    Descrição:
    O parâmetro MV_FORMALI define a fórmula padrão utilizada para o rateio do desconto informado em um orçamento.

    Fórmula padrão:
    PRECO MINIMO MARGEM DE LUCRO = (NPERCMIN / 100) * SB2->B2_CM1 + SB2->B2_CM1

    Essa fórmula considera o custo do produto (SB2->B2_CM1) somado ao percentual mínimo de margem de lucro definido pela política (NPERCMIN).

    Funcionamento:

    Na rotina de Orçamento por Fases, ao informar um valor fixo no campo "Vl. Pretendid", o sistema distribui o desconto proporcionalmente entre os produtos do orçamento para atingir o valor total desejado.

    Durante esse rateio, o parâmetro MV_FORMALI é utilizado para assegurar que o valor final de venda de cada item, já com o desconto aplicado, não seja inferior ao valor mínimo permitido pela margem de lucro configurada. Dessa forma, o sistema evita prejuízos, respeitando os limites comerciais estabelecidos.

    Importante:

    • A variável NPERCMIN representa o valor do campo "% Margem Min.", configurado na rotina de Critério de Descontos.

    • Essa configuração é essencial para que o sistema possa calcular corretamente o limite mínimo de venda de cada item com base na política de margem definida.

    Image Added


    04. DEMAIS INFORMAÇÕES

    • Não há

    12.1.2210: Pendente de liberação.

    12.1.2310: Pendente de liberação.

    ...

    • .

    05. ASSUNTOS RELACIONADOS

    ...